
Description
Key-notes of American Liberty is a rare, Civil War-era collection of iconic American speeches and documents. It includes some of the most American-defining pieces including:
George Washingtons Farewell Address
the Declaration of Independence
The Constitution
Amendments to the Constitution
Fugitive Slave bills
Missouri Compromise
Dred Scott case decision
Monroe Doctrine
Abraham Lincolns Inaugural addresses
Bibliographic Details
Title: Key-notes of American Liberty: Comprising the Most Important Speeches, Proclamations, and Acts of Congress
Author(s): United States
Publisher: New York: E.B. Treat; Chicago, Ill.: R.C. Treat and C.W. Lilley
Edition: 1866 edition
Binding: Hardcover
Format: (12mo), single volume
Size: 7.5 in x 5 in (19 cm x 13 cm)
Collation: [viii], 273, [3] p
Illustrations: added color title page, frontispiece portrait of Washington
